Back To School hundreds DRUG-FREE MARSHALS in Tampa and Clearwater

The Foundation for a Drug-Free World (Florida Chapter) joined the Greenwood Back to School event in Clearwater and the Hillsborough Back to School event in Tampa to help instill an awareness of the dangers of illicit drugs amongst our youth. Those who stopped by the Foundation for a Drug-Free World booth experienced the high interest that their message evokes. In total, over 450 Drug-Free Marshals were signed up, and more than 600 Truth About Drugs booklets were distributed to parents and youth.

The Drug Free Marshals is a youth drug-education and prevention program that informs children about the dangers of drugs, and challenges them to remain drug-free. They demonstrate their commitment by being “sworn in” as Drug-Free Marshals, pledging to remain drug free and to encourage their peers to do the same.

This is the fourth year the Foundation participated in these Back to School events.
The events are intended to help get the parents and kids ready for the new school year. The role of the Foundation for a Drug-Free World is to give the kids the tools they need to say no to drugs and have a productive, drug-free school year.

“Youth are starting to experiment with drugs at a younger and younger age. We want to reach them before drugs do,” said Julieta Santagostino the director of the Florida Chapter of the Foundation for a Drug-Free World.

The Foundation for a Drug-Free World is a nonprofit public benefit corporation that empowers youth and adults with factual information about drugs so they can make informed decisions and live drug-free. For more information go to: www.drugfreeworld.org
